Our employees are not only part of history, they're making history.Northrop Grumman is looking for a Principal or Sr. Principal Talent Acquisition Business Partner to support our Weapon Systems Division in our Defense Systems Sector.
This position will be full time remote.
The successful candidate must be able to work in a high-volume, fast-paced environment with the ability to provide consultative guidance to hiring managers and candidates throughout the selection process.
Responsibilities:

Provide sourcing focused full-life cycle recruiting, to include screening, qualifying, interviewing and managing candidate relationships while advising hiring managers through the assessment and selection process.
Accurately assesses candidates for cultural, competency and skill fit, quickly synthesizes candidate and hiring manager feedback and routinely pre-closes candidates to ensure high acceptance rates.
Acts as a business partner by advising hiring managers on effective interviewing techniques and collaborates with others throughout the organization to ensure a smooth process and meeting required business objectives.
Possesses the business acumen to influence key stakeholders, develop trusting relationships and effects business outcomes.
Effectively leverages other functional areas as well as utilizing data and market intelligence when advising the business and executing staffing strategies.
Understands and adheres to compliance, diversity and talent acquisition processes.
Exhibits the actions and behaviors that demonstrate the Leadership Characteristics.
This position can be filled with either a Principal Talent Acquisition Business Partner or Sr. Principal Talent Acquisition Business Partner, depending on years of experience and qualifications.
